AB: The global coarse resolution latitude/longitude land surface albedo data sets derived from the Terra MODerate resolution Imaging Spectroradiometer (MODIS) have been completed for use by the global modeling community. This paper describes these Bidirectional Reflectance Distribution Function (BRDF) and Albedo Climate Model Grid (CMG) products and their variability within major global vegetation types. Preliminary results reveal that these coarse resolution global albedos have the spatial and latitudinal patterns appropriate for the underlying IGBP land cover classes, further encouraging modelers to introduce albedos as variants of ground cover, geographic location, temporal season and spatial resolution in the various climate modeling schemes.
